body{font-family:serif;background:url(https://www.informatics.akita-u.ac.jp/wp-content/uploads/particle-static.png);background-size:936px 1041px;background-position:0 -56px}#particles-bg>canvas{display:block;vertical-align:bottom}#particles-bg{background-color:#fff;background-image:url("");background-repeat:no-repeat;background-size:cover;background-position:50% 50%;position:absolute;z-index:-1;width:100%;height:936px}.l-footer .-widget1 a{text-decoration-color:#aaa}.l-footer .-widget1 strong{font-size:200%;font-weight:300}@media (max-width:999px){.w-footer.-widget2{display:none}.l-footer .-widget1{font-size:.9em}.l-footer .-widget1 strong{font-size:170%}}@media (min-width:1000px){.l-footer__nav{display:none}}:root{--ark-color--header_bg:#fffe;--ark-color--footer_bg:#fff6}.l-header[data-pcfix="0"]{--ark-color--header_bg:#fffe}[data-scrolled=false] .l-header[data-pcfix="1"]{--ark-color--header_bg:#0002}ul.sub-menu>li.menu-item{--ark-menulist_border:none}.w-footer.-widget2 .has-child--acc .sub-menu{position:fixed}.w-footer.-widget2 .has-child--acc .is-opened.sub-menu{position:relative}:where(.wp-block-button__link){border-radius:var(--arkb-btn-radius,0)}.wp-block-button:not(.is-style-outline) .wp-block-button__link{opacity:.7}.wp-block-categories-list .cat-item-1,.wp-block-categories-list .cat-item-22,.wp-block-categories-list .cat-item-39{display:none}.ib-toc-container .ib-toc-header{display:none}.ib-toc-container .ib-toc-separator{background-color:#1113}.p-topArea{padding-top:40px}.p-topArea.-noimg{background:#555a;min-height:150px}img.toparea-title-icon-img{width:70px;margin-bottom:-5px;float:center;filter:drop-shadow(0px 0px 1.5px #0009)}.page-template-icon-title-page .p-topArea{min-height:150px;padding-top:40px}@media not all and (min-width:1000px){img.toparea-title-icon-img{width:60px}.page-template-icon-title-page .p-topArea{min-height:150px;max-height:150px;padding-top:40px}}.page-template-icon-title-page .p-topArea__body{text-shadow:0px 0px 3px #0009}.page-template-icon-title-page{--ark-width--article:var(--ark-width--article--slim)}.page-template-icon-title-page .c-filterLayer.-filter-dot:before{opacity:.7;background:linear-gradient(90deg,#f2a0a1,#cd8c5c,#69b076,#84a2d4,#756385);background-size:400% 100%;animation:bggradient 40s ease infinite}@keyframes bggradient{0%{background-position:0 50%}50%{background-position:100% 50%}100%{background-position:0 50%}}@media screen and (max-width:767px){br.ps-br{display:none}}@media screen and (min-width:767px){br.sp-br{display:none}}.text-tate{writing-mode:vertical-rl;text-orientation:upright}.text-tate-right.wp-block-heading{writing-mode:vertical-rl;text-orientation:upright;float:right;width:100%;margin-top:0;margin-bottom:16px;margin-right:5px}.tatelogo2{width:95vw;position:relative;left:50%;transform:translateX(-50%);grid-template-columns:auto 110px !important;gap:5px;padding-left:20px}.tatelogo2>.wp-block-media-text__media{align-self:auto;max-width:88px;margin-right:20px;margin-top:15px;margin-bottom:15px}.tatelogo2>.wp-block-media-text__media img.wp-image-1096{padding-top:20px;padding-bottom:20px}.home .l-header{position:absolute;background:0 0}.home .l-header__body{grid-template-areas:"menu search left center right";grid-template-columns:var(--ark-drawerW) var(--ark-searchW) auto 50% 25%}.home .l-header__searchBtn{grid-area:menu;z-index:1;top:40px}.home .l-header__body{padding-left:13px;padding-right:13px;max-width:none}.home .l-header__logo{width:0;height:40px}@media screen and (max-width:599px){.tatelogo2{grid-template-columns:auto 90px !important}.tatelogo2>.wp-block-media-text__media{max-width:77px}.home .l-header__logo{width:0;height:30px}}.home div#n2-ss-1 .nextend-bullet-bar{display:inherit}.show-nojs{display:none}.main-buttons{width:50px;top:100px;left:-5px;display:flex;position:absolute}.main-buttons.wp-block-buttons.wp-block-buttons{gap:2px}.main-buttons .wp-block-button.wp-block-button .wp-block-button__link{line-height:1.2em}@media not all and (min-width:1000px){.tatelogo2{width:100vw;padding-left:35px}.main-buttons{left:-14px;font-size:90%}}@media not all and (min-width:600px){.tatelogo2{padding-left:0}.main-buttons{left:calc(50% - 50vw + var(--ark-scrollbar_width) /2 + 20px);width:calc(100vw - var(--ark-scrollbar_width) - 40px);max-width:100vw !important;position:relative;top:0}.main-buttons.wp-block-buttons.wp-block-buttons{justify-content:center;align-items:unset;flex-wrap:nowrap;flex-direction:row;gap:3px}.main-buttons .wp-block-button.wp-block-button .wp-block-button__link{padding-left:20px !important;padding-right:20px !important}}.postlist-at-home{list-style:none}.postlist-at-home ul{list-style:none;padding:inherit}.postlist-at-home a{color:#373e47;display:flex;text-decoration:none;flex-wrap:wrap;width:calc(100% + 35px);line-height:1em;position:relative;margin-top:5px;margin-left:-30px}.postlist-at-home a:hover{opacity:.7;background-color:#ddd1}.postlist-at-home time{padding-bottom:3px;margin-right:20px;line-height:1.3em;white-space:wrap;letter-spacing:normal;display:block;width:160px;padding-top:11px;float:left;text-align:right}.postlist-at-home time>br{display:none}.postlist-at-home-cat{vertical-align:baseline;font-weight:600;max-width:100px;width:100%;font-size:.8em;align-self:baseline;align-items:center;justify-content:center;border-radius:0;border:1px solid;white-space:nowrap;background-color:#fffb;position:relative;top:1px;line-height:1em;padding:6px 10px;margin:7px 20px 7px 0;display:inline-grid;letter-spacing:normal;float:left}.postlist-at-home .postlist-title{word-break:break-all;white-space:normal;letter-spacing:normal;width:100%;line-height:1.3em;position:relative;top:11px;display:block;margin-bottom:.7em}.postlist-at-home-li a{display:inline-table;word-break:break-all;white-space:nowrap;letter-spacing:-1em}@media screen and (max-width:47.9375em){.postlist-at-home-li a{display:inherit;margin-top:20px;border-bottom:1px solid #1114;margin-left:inherit;width:100%}.postlist-at-home time{vertical-align:baseline;padding-bottom:10px;margin-left:5px;white-space:nowrap;display:inline-grid;width:auto;float:none;text-align:inherit}.postlist-at-home time>br{display:none}.postlist-at-home-cat{display:inline-grid;float:none;margin:0;top:-2px}.postlist-at-home .postlist-title{display:block;margin-top:5px;margin-left:5px;margin-bottom:15px;width:100%;position:inherit;top:0}}.cat-news,.p-archive [data-cat-id="19"],.cat-item.cat-item-19{color:#cd2d2d}.p-archive .p-postList__category svg,.p-archive .c-postTimes__item svg{display:none}.p-archive .c-postTimes__item{font-size:1.5em;min-width:90px}.cat-event,.p-archive [data-cat-id="20"],.cat-item.cat-item-20{color:#47881e}.cat-admission,.p-archive [data-cat-id="21"],.cat-item.cat-item-21{color:#1a76b3}.cat-video,.p-archive [data-cat-id="34"],.cat-item.cat-item-34{color:#9452b1}.p-archive [data-cat-id],.p-archive [data-cat-id="19"],.p-archive [data-cat-id="20"],.p-archive [data-cat-id="21"],.p-archive [data-cat-id="34"]{border:1px solid;padding:4px 8px;margin:5px 20px 5px 0;font-weight:600}.su-posts.su-posts-staff{grid-template-columns:repeat(1,1fr);margin-bottom:4rem!important;display:grid;gap:10px}@media (min-width:768px){.su-posts.su-posts-staff{grid-template-columns:repeat(2,1fr)}}.su-posts.su-posts-staff a.su-posts-staff-item{color:#373e47;text-decoration:none}.su-posts.su-posts-staff .left{min-width:89px;min-height:98px;max-width:89px;max-height:98px}.su-posts.su-posts-staff .left img{width:100%;height:100%;border-radius:5px;object-fit:cover}.su-posts.su-posts-staff .right{width:100%}.su-posts.su-posts-staff .right .title{padding:4px;display:block;border-bottom:1px solid #cbced8;font-size:1.1em;font-weight:600;line-height:1.4}.su-posts.su-posts-staff .right .staff-researchgroup{display:inline-block;float:right}.su-posts.su-posts-staff .right .su-posts-staff-jtitle{font-size:.9em;margin-right:4px}.su-posts.su-posts-staff .right .su-posts-staff-jtitleen{font-size:.6em;font-weight:500;margin-right:4px}.su-posts.su-posts-staff .right .su-posts-staff-nameen{font-size:.7em;font-weight:500}.staff-researchgroup-item{display:none;border:3px solid;height:1em;margin-top:5px}.post-62 .arkb-tabList__button>kbd{border:3px solid;box-shadow:none;padding:0;margin-left:5px;height:1em;border-radius:0}.arkb-tabList__button[aria-controls=tab-f94db101-1]>kbd{color:#dd333377}.staff-researchgroup-item.researchgroup-robot{color:#dd333377;display:inline-flex}.arkb-tabList__button[aria-controls=tab-f94db101-2]>kbd{color:#3b9b0077}.staff-researchgroup-item.researchgroup-ds{color:#3b9b0077;display:inline-flex}.arkb-tabList__button[aria-controls=tab-f94db101-3]>kbd{color:#1a76b377}.staff-researchgroup-item.researchgroup-hcc{color:#1a76b377;display:inline-flex}.su-posts.su-posts-staff .right .text{display:block;padding-top:10px;margin-bottom:5px}.su-posts-staff .su-posts-staff-item{background-color:#e7e7e782;padding:10px 20px 10px 10px;display:none;column-gap:20px !important;margin-bottom:0 !important}.su-posts-staff.show-staff-all>.su-posts-staff-item.staff-all{display:flex !important}.su-posts.su-posts-single-post .su-post{margin-bottom:0;line-height:inherit}